How to End Gout for Good

Dealing with frequent gout attacks can be incredibly frustrating, but it doesn't mean you’re obligated to a life of joint discomfort. Effectively managing gout often involves a all-around approach. Firstly, modifying your diet is key - reducing intake of purine-rich foods like red poultry, organ items and sugary beverages can make a significant impact. Secondly, staying adequately hydrated by drinking plenty of water helps your kidneys flush out uric acid. Furthermore, your physician may prescribe medications to lower uric acid amounts; adhering strictly to the prescribed regimen is absolutely essential. Finally, maintaining a healthy weight and addressing underlying medical ailments like high treat gout blood pressure or diabetes can drastically reduce your risk of future gout occurrences. Ending Gout Attacks: A Complete Plan

Suffering with a gout flare-up ? Regaining control over your condition requires a comprehensive plan. This isn't just about easing the present pain; it’s about preventing future recurrences . Here's a step-by-step guide to help you navigate this journey, focusing on both severe relief and long-term management. Firstly, address the immediate discomfort with rest, ice packs applied for 20 minutes at a time, elevation of the affected joint, and potentially over-the-counter pain relievers – always consulting your physician beforehand. Secondly, dietary adjustments are key; limit foods high in purines like red meat, organ meats, and certain seafood such as shrimp or shellfish. Focus on hydration: aim for at least eight glasses of water each day . Finally, long-term prevention often involves medication prescribed by your healthcare provider to lower uric acid levels; adherence to this regimen is absolutely crucial.
